Description: Unique 72 hour design course including basic concepts of permaculture, located at Koinonia Farm, in Americus, GA. Koinonia is a 67 year old intentional community and working farm, where members are active in Peace and Justice work, and many permaculture systems are in place or being designed, such as rotational grazing, organic pecan trials, village living, organic gardens, swaling and other water harvesting, and more.
Course will include extra events pertinent to the area, such as a visit to Habitat for Humanity’s Global Village, optional trip to Plains, GA, panel discussions, films and information about the area and it’s rich history.
